BENGALURU: After all the brouhaha, BS Yeddyurappa, state BJP president and opposition leader in the legislative assembly, has decided to take possession of government bungalow No 4.Yeddyurappa had refused to accept the bungalow allotted to him in July after he was denied his ‘lucky’ bungalow No 2 on Race Course Road in Bengaluru..
